Scenario planning is a strategy used to consider possible future events for an organization or project to develop an effective and relevant long-term plan to respond positively to that change.

The use of capital budgeting offers an objective view that helps managers figure out how to invest capital in order to increase business value but also helps the overall health of the company. The time value of money is about the potential rate of return on the investment as well as the reduced purchasing power over time due to inflation.
